No Sound or Audio Distortion

Troubleshooting Common Speaker Problems Solutions and Tips 1

No Sound

Possible Causes:

  • Disconnected or loose cables: Check if the speaker cables are securely connected to both the speaker and the audio source. Loose connections can result in no sound output.
  • Mute or low volume setting: Ensure that the volume is not muted, and the volume level is set to an audible level on both the audio source and the speaker.
  • Faulty power source: If your speaker requires power, make sure it’s plugged in or that the batteries are not depleted.

Solutions:

  • Reconnect and secure all cables, ensuring they are properly plugged in.
  • Adjust the volume settings on both the audio source and the speaker.
  • Check and replace batteries or ensure the power source is functioning correctly.

Audio Distortion

Possible Causes:

  • Overloading the speaker: Playing audio at maximum volume for extended periods can cause distortion due to speaker overload.
  • Damaged speaker driver: Physical damage to the speaker driver can result in distorted audio.
  • Interference: External factors like electronic interference can cause audio distortion.

Solutions:

  • Avoid playing audio at maximum volume for extended periods to prevent speaker overload.
  • If the speaker driver is damaged, consider repairing or replacing it.
  • Check for sources of interference, such as electronic devices or Wi-Fi routers, and relocate the speaker if necessary.

Bluetooth Connection Issues

Bluetooth Connection Issues

Pairing Problems

Possible Causes:

  • Incorrect pairing: Incorrectly entering the pairing code or not following the pairing instructions can lead to connection issues.
  • Distance or obstructions: Bluetooth connections have a limited range, and physical obstructions between the speaker and the audio source can disrupt the connection.
  • Multiple paired devices: If the speaker is paired with multiple devices, it may struggle to connect to the desired source.

Solutions:

  • Double-check the pairing code and follow the pairing instructions precisely.
  • Ensure the speaker and audio source are within the recommended Bluetooth range and free from obstructions.
  • Disconnect or unpair the speaker from other devices to prevent interference.

Audio Dropouts or Lag

Possible Causes:

  • Interference: Interference from other electronic devices or Wi-Fi networks can cause audio dropouts or lag in Bluetooth connections.
  • Outdated firmware: Outdated firmware on the speaker or audio source can lead to compatibility issues and audio problems.

Solutions:

  • Identify and eliminate sources of interference, such as nearby electronic devices or Wi-Fi routers.
  • Check for firmware updates for both the speaker and the audio source and install any available updates.

Uneven Sound or Imbalanced Audio

Uneven Sound Output

Possible Causes:

Uneven Sound or Imbalanced Audio

  • Speaker placement: The placement of the speaker in the room can affect sound distribution and result in uneven sound.
  • Audio source settings: Incorrect audio settings on the source device can cause uneven sound output.

Solutions:

  • Experiment with different speaker placements in the room to achieve balanced sound distribution.
  • Check and adjust the audio settings on the source device, ensuring that the balance is centered.

Imbalanced Audio Channels

Possible Causes:

  • Faulty speaker connections: Loose or damaged speaker cables can lead to imbalanced audio channels.
  • Speaker or amplifier issues: Problems with the speaker drivers or the amplifier can result in imbalanced audio.

Solutions:

  • Inspect and securely connect all speaker cables.
  • Test the speaker with different audio sources to determine if the imbalance is consistent.
  • If the issue persists, consider professional servicing or repair of the speaker.

Speaker Overheating and Shutdown

Speaker Overheating

Possible Causes:

  • High volume usage: Prolonged use at high volumes can cause speakers to overheat.
  • Inadequate ventilation: Poor ventilation around the speaker can lead to overheating.

Solutions:

  • Avoid extended periods of high-volume usage to prevent overheating.
  • Ensure the speaker has adequate ventilation, and avoid placing it in enclosed spaces.

Speaker Shutdown

Possible Causes:

  • Overheating: Overheating can trigger built-in safety mechanisms that shut down the speaker to prevent damage.
  • Power supply issues: Inconsistent power supply or voltage fluctuations can lead to speaker shutdowns.

Solutions:

  • Allow the speaker to cool down if it has overheated, and then resume usage at lower volumes.
  • Ensure a stable and consistent power supply to prevent shutdowns due to power issues.

Rattling or Buzzing Sounds

Rattling or Buzzing Sounds

Possible Causes:

  • Loose or damaged components: Loose speaker components or damage to the speaker driver can result in rattling or buzzing sounds.
  • External objects: Foreign objects or debris near the speaker can cause unwanted vibrations.

Solutions:

  • Inspect the speaker for loose components or damaged parts, and repair or replace as needed.
  • Remove any foreign objects or debris from the vicinity of the speaker to eliminate vibrations.
